Super Mario Bros.

"This ain't no game."

1993
1h 44m
4.5(1374 votes)
Adventure
Fantasy
Comedy
Family

Overview

Mario and Luigi, plumbers from Brooklyn, find themselves in an alternate universe where evolved dinosaurs live in hi-tech squalor. They're the only hope to save our universe from invasion by the dino dictator, Koopa.
